ABOUT ST. LAWRENCE COUNTY

St. Lawrence County is located in Northern New York along the Canadian border. The Adirondack Mountains lie to the east, the Thousand Islands to the south, and the St. Lawrence River to the northwest. Situated on the Canadian border, the county benefits from trade with Canada. The region has an abundance of hydropower, providing affordable power for residents of the area. The county also has a low crime rate and strong K-12 education.

According to the St. Lawrence County Industrial Development Agency, “The County’s relatively sparse population (42 people  per square mile) has the advantage of affording ample acreages of greenspace and fresh water that not  only attract tourists but are also key components of the quality of life in the County for residents who want to hunt, fish, boat, engage in winter sports, or simply enjoy the great outdoors. The southwestern part of the County is in the Thousand Islands region and about a third of the County lies in the Adirondack  Park – in which the County’s Five Ponds wilderness has one of the last stands of virgin timber in the State.”
